Bachelor Party in Pattaya: 4-Day Itinerary

Saturday, September 9: Arrival and Nightlife

Welcome to Pattaya! After arriving at the airport, check-in at your hotel and freshen up. In the morning, explore the city's beaches like Pattaya Beach or Jomtien Beach, where you can relax, soak up the sun, and enjoy water sports activities. In the afternoon, head to Walking Street, the famous nightlife hotspot, known for its vibrant clubs, bars, and entertainment venues. Indulge in the energetic atmosphere and party till dawn. Don't miss the chance to experience the renowned Tiffany's Show or Alcazar Cabaret, the captivating ladyboy cabaret shows.

  • Pattaya Beach or Jomtien Beach: Cost varies depending on activities | Time spent: Half-day
  • Walking Street: Cost varies depending on venues | Time spent: Evening to late night
  • Tiffany's Show or Alcazar Cabaret: Cost varies depending on show | Time spent: 1-2 hours
Sunday, September 10: Adventure and Water Sports

Get ready for an adrenaline-filled day! Start your morning with a visit to Nong Nooch Tropical Garden, a beautiful botanical garden offering stunning landscapes and cultural shows. In the afternoon, head to Pattaya's famous Coral Island (Koh Larn) and indulge in exciting water sports like snorkeling, parasailing, or jet skiing. Relax on the pristine beaches or explore the island on a rented buggy. In the evening, enjoy a delicious seafood dinner at one of the beachside restaurants.

  • Nong Nooch Tropical Garden: Entrance fee around INR 800 | Time spent: Half-day
  • Coral Island (Koh Larn): Cost varies depending on activities | Time spent: Half-day
  • Seafood Dinner: Cost varies depending on restaurant | Time spent: Evening
Monday, September 11: Pattaya City Exploration

Immerse yourself in the vibrant city of Pattaya today. Start your morning with a visit to the Sanctuary of Truth, a magnificent wooden temple showcasing intricate carvings and cultural heritage. In the afternoon, explore the Pattaya Viewpoint, offering panoramic views of the city and its coastline. Visit the Ripley's Believe It or Not! Museum for quirky exhibits or enjoy the Underwater World Pattaya, a marine aquarium featuring a fascinating range of sea creatures. In the evening, explore the Art in Paradise Museum, where you can become a part of optical illusion artworks.

  • Sanctuary of Truth: Entrance fee around INR 1000 | Time spent: 2-3 hours
  • Pattaya Viewpoint: Free admission | Time spent: 1-2 hours
  • Ripley's Believe It or Not! Museum: Entrance fee around INR 800 | Time spent: 1-2 hours
  • Underwater World Pattaya: Entrance fee around INR 600 | Time spent: 2-3 hours
  • Art in Paradise Museum: Entrance fee around INR 500 | Time spent: 1-2 hours
Tuesday, September 12: Relaxation and Farewell

On your last day in Pattaya, take some time to relax and rejuvenate. Visit the Pattaya Floating Market, where you can explore the vibrant market on boats, shop for local handicrafts, and savor delicious street food. In the afternoon, pamper yourself with a traditional Thai massage or spa treatment to unwind. End your trip by experiencing the famous Alangkarn Show, a cultural extravaganza featuring a blend of Thai traditions, music, and dance. Bid farewell to Pattaya with unforgettable memories!

  • Pattaya Floating Market: Entrance fee around INR 300 | Time spent: 2-3 hours
  • Thai Massage or Spa Treatment: Cost varies depending on services | Time spent: 1-2 hours
  • Alangkarn Show: Cost varies depending on show | Time spent: 2-3 hours

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

For a unique and off the beaten path experience, consider visiting Pattaya's Silverlake Vineyard, where you can enjoy wine tasting amidst picturesque vineyards and beautiful landscapes. If you're looking for adventure, explore the Flight of the Gibbon, an exhilarating zipline adventure through the lush jungles near Pattaya. For a more laid-back experience, head to the nearby island of Koh Samet, known for its pristine beaches and relaxing atmosphere. These hidden gems and local favorites offer a different perspective of Pattaya beyond the usual party scene, making your bachelor party trip even more memorable.
